Board fence installation involves constructing a sturdy, wooden barrier made up of evenly spaced vertical boards attached to horizontal rails. This type of fencing is a popular choice for homeowners seeking a classic, attractive look that provides privacy and defines property boundaries. Skilled contractors typically handle the entire process, from selecting quality materials to ensuring the fence is properly anchored and level. Proper installation ensures the fence remains durable over time, resisting weather and wear, and maintaining its appearance for years to come.

The overview below groups typical Board Fence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Minor fence fixes or short sections typ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repair jobs fall into this range, depending on the extent of damage and materials used.
Basic Fence Installation - Installing a new standard board or chain-link fence usually ranges from $1,500 to $3,000 for many residential projects. Most installations are completed within this middle price band.
Full Fence Replacement - Replacing an entire fence, especially larger or more complex projects, can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Fewer projects reach into the highest tiers, which involve premium materials or extensive customization.
Custom or Specialty Fences - High-end or custom-designed fences, such as ornamental iron or privacy fences with unique features, can cost $10,000+ depending on size and complexity. These projects are less common but represent the upper end of typical cost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ing a board fence? A board fence can provide privacy, define property boundaries, and enhance the aesthetic appeal of a yard.
What types of wood are commonly used for board fences? Common options include cedar, pine, and redwood, each offering different durability and appearance qualities.
Can local contractors customize the height and style of a board fence? Yes, many service providers offer customization options to match specific preferences and property requirements.
What factors should be considered when choosing a board fence design? Considerations include privacy needs, local climate, property layout, and personal style preferences.
How do local contractors handle the installation process? Experienced service providers typically handle all aspects of installation, including site preparation, post setting, and finishing touches.
